基于STM32的智能厨房环境检测系统设计PPT
概述基于STM32的智能厨房环境检测系统设计旨在实现厨房内部环境参数的实时监控和智能调控。系统利用STM32微控制器作为核心处理单元,结合多种传感器,检测...
概述基于STM32的智能厨房环境检测系统设计旨在实现厨房内部环境参数的实时监控和智能调控。系统利用STM32微控制器作为核心处理单元,结合多种传感器,检测厨房内的温度、湿度、烟雾、燃气泄漏等关键环境参数,并通过显示屏或手机APP展示给用户。同时,系统具备报警和自动调控功能,以确保厨房安全并优化烹饪环境。系统总体设计系统总体设计包括硬件和软件两大部分。硬件部分主要由STM32微控制器、传感器模块、通信模块、显示模块、报警模块等构成。软件部分则包括系统初始化、数据采集、数据处理、通信协议、用户界面等。系统硬件模块设计STM32微控制器模块STM32微控制器作为系统核心,负责数据采集、处理和控制。选用合适型号的STM32,确保性能稳定且满足系统需求。传感器模块传感器模块包括温度传感器、湿度传感器、烟雾传感器和燃气泄漏传感器。这些传感器负责实时采集厨房内的环境参数,并将数据传输给STM32微控制器。通信模块通信模块用于实现系统与其他设备或用户界面的通信。可选的通信方式有Wi-Fi、蓝牙等。显示模块显示模块用于展示环境参数和系统状态。可选用LCD或OLED显示屏,也可通过手机APP实现远程查看。报警模块报警模块在检测到异常环境参数时发出报警信号,提醒用户注意安全。报警方式可以是声光报警或手机推送通知。系统软件设计系统初始化系统上电后,首先进行初始化操作,包括配置STM32微控制器、初始化传感器和通信模块等。数据采集与处理STM32微控制器定时从传感器模块读取环境参数数据,并进行处理和分析。如果发现异常数据,立即触发报警模块。通信协议系统采用标准的通信协议,如MQTT或CoAP,实现与其他设备或云平台的通信。用户界面用户界面包括本地显示界面和远程手机APP界面。用户可以通过界面查看环境参数、控制系统状态等。系统设备说明STM32微控制器选用STM32F4系列微控制器,具有高性能、低功耗等特点,满足系统需求。传感器模块传感器模块包括DHT11温湿度传感器、MQ-2烟雾传感器和燃气泄漏传感器。这些传感器具有高精度、快速响应等特点。通信模块通信模块选用Wi-Fi模块,实现系统与互联网的连接,方便用户远程查看和控制。显示模块选用OLED显示屏,具有高清晰度、低功耗等优点。同时,系统也支持通过手机APP查看环境参数。报警模块报警模块采用蜂鸣器和LED灯组合,实现声光报警功能。同时,系统也支持通过手机APP推送通知报警信息。系统的安装调试系统安装将STM32微控制器、传感器模块、通信模块、显示模块和报警模块按照设计要求进行连接和固定。确保各模块之间的连接稳定可靠。系统调试在系统安装完成后进行调试工作。首先检查各模块的工作状态是否正常,然后测试系统的数据采集、处理和通信功能是否满足要求。如果发现问题及时进行调整和修复。系统测试在系统调试完成后进行系统测试。模拟各种实际场景测试系统的稳定性和可靠性。同时邀请用户进行实际使用测试,收集反馈意见并进行改进。系统维护定期对系统进行维护和保养,确保系统的长期稳定运行。根据用户反馈和市场需求进行系统的升级和改进。